The Rising Cost of Frights: A Deeper Dive

So, why exactly are these Halloweekend cover prices climbing higher than a witch on a broomstick? It's a question many of us are asking, and the answer, like a good mystery, has a few layers. Event organizers often cite increased operational costs as a primary reason. Think about it: elaborate decorations that have to be sourced and installed, specialized lighting and sound systems to create that eerie ambiance, and of course, the talent. Whether it's DJs spinning spooky tunes or actors providing the scares in a haunted house, skilled performers and staff need to be compensated fairly. Then there's the marketing and promotion aspect. Getting the word out about these epic events requires significant investment in advertising, social media campaigns, and sometimes even influencer partnerships. On top of that, venues themselves have costs – rent, utilities, security, insurance – and these aren't exactly cheap, especially for prime locations that draw a large crowd. Add in the need for enhanced security measures during a high-traffic event like Halloweekend, and the budget balloons even further. It’s not just about the glitz and gore; it’s about ensuring a safe and enjoyable experience for everyone. Inflation is another massive factor. We're all feeling it in our daily lives, from groceries to gas, and event planning is no exception. The cost of materials, services, and even basic supplies has gone up, directly impacting the bottom line for organizers. They have to either absorb these costs, which can be unsustainable, or pass them on to the attendees. And let’s be honest, they usually opt for the latter. Furthermore, the demand for unique experiences has also surged. People are looking for more than just a basic party; they want immersive, Instagram-worthy events that offer something truly special. Creating these kinds of elaborate experiences requires a bigger investment, which, you guessed it, translates into higher ticket prices. It’s a bit of a catch-22: we want cooler, more elaborate Halloweekend celebrations, but we’re not always prepared for the price tag that comes with them. So, while it might feel like a shocking price increase, there are often legitimate reasons behind the hikes. However, that doesn’t make it any easier on our wallets, does it? Navigating the Spooky Spending: Tips for Smart Celebrations

Alright guys, so we’ve established that Halloweekend cover prices can be, shall we say, spooktacularly high. But don't let your Halloween spirit go entirely ghost! There are still plenty of ways to enjoy the season without completely draining your bank account. First off, early bird tickets are your best friend. Seriously, if you know you want to hit up a specific event, book it as soon as they go on sale. Organizers often offer significant discounts for those who commit early, and it’s a fantastic way to save some serious cash. Keep an eye out for promo codes and discounts. Social media is your go-to for this. Follow your favorite venues, event promoters, and even local Halloween enthusiasts; they often share discount codes or run contests. You might just snag a cheaper ticket or even a free pass! Another great strategy is to host your own Halloweekend party. Instead of paying a hefty cover charge to attend someone else's bash, why not throw your own? You have complete control over the guest list, the music, the decorations, and most importantly, the cost. Potluck style can be a lifesaver, with everyone bringing a dish to share, significantly cutting down on food expenses. Plus, a DIY party often feels more personal and can be just as much, if not more, fun! Consider alternative Halloweekend activities. Not everything has to be a ticketed event. Think about visiting a local pumpkin patch, having a horror movie marathon at home (popcorn is way cheaper than a VIP pass!), going for a scenic drive to admire spooky decorations in neighborhoods known for their displays, or even organizing a costume scavenger hunt with friends. These options offer plenty of Halloween fun without the hefty price tag. Group discounts are also a thing! If you're planning to go out with a crew, check if the venue offers discounts for groups. Buying tickets together can sometimes lead to a better overall price. And finally, prioritize what’s important to you. If a specific, high-end event is a must-do, figure out where you can save money elsewhere in your Halloweekend budget to accommodate it. Maybe you skip the elaborate costume this year and opt for something simpler, or perhaps you prepare your own snacks and drinks beforehand. It’s all about making smart choices that align with your budget and your desire to have a memorable Halloweekend without the financial fright.
